Summary:

The Senior Principal Enterprise Architect - Data Architecture & Strategy is a senior individual contributor within the Enterprise Architecture team responsible for defining the organization's enterprise data architecture vision, future-state data ecosystem, and strategic technology direction. This role establishes the architectural principles, standards, roadmaps, and governance frameworks that enable trusted, secure, interoperable, and scalable data capabilities across clinical, research, operational, financial, and AI domains.

Serving as the enterprise architecture leader for data, the role translates business, technology, and Data & Analytics strategies into actionable architecture guidance, reference architectures, and technology investment recommendations. The position provides architectural leadership for modern data platforms, Data Product architecture, data governance, metadata management, semantic frameworks, and AI-ready data foundations, ensuring data assets are reusable, governed, and aligned to enterprise objectives.

Working closely with Data & Analytics leadership, Data Product teams, security, privacy, and business stakeholders, the architect drives enterprise-wide alignment of data architecture decisions, technology standards, and governance practices. This role provides strategic oversight and thought leadership to help the organization maximize the value of its data investments while enabling analytics, AI, research, and digital transformation initiatives.

Responsibilities:

  • Define and maintain the enterprise data architecture strategy, future-state architecture vision, and multi-year technology roadmap in partnership with Data & Analytics leadership and business stakeholders.
  • Translate business, clinical, research, operational, analytics, and AI strategies into actionable data architecture direction, target-state architectures, and technology investment recommendations.
  • Establish and govern enterprise data architecture principles, standards, reference architectures, and design patterns for data integration, storage, modeling, sharing, and consumption.
  • Lead the development of enterprise architecture guidance and strategic direction for modern data platforms, including lakehouse architectures, cloud data platforms, Databricks, metadata management, data quality, lineage, and data catalog capabilities.
  • Define enterprise Data Product architecture standards, operating principles, and reusable architectural patterns that enable scalable, interoperable, governed, and discoverable Data Products.
  • Partner with Data & Analytics, Data Product, AI, and engineering leaders to align architecture, platform, and product roadmaps while promoting enterprise-wide consistency, interoperability, and reuse.
  • Participate in Architecture Review Boards and governance forums, providing architectural oversight and guidance for major data initiatives, technology investments, and strategic programs.
  • Lead technology assessments and platform evaluations for data, analytics, governance, integration, and AI technologies, providing evidence-based recommendations for adoption, standardization, and investment decisions.
  • Establish architectural foundations for AI-ready data, including data quality, semantic models, metadata frameworks, ontology and knowledge architectures, feature engineering, and model-ready data capabilities.
  • Partner with enterprise data governance stakeholders to advance data classification, master data management, lineage, privacy, security, and regulatory compliance frameworks for enterprise data assets.
  • Serve as a trusted advisor to executive leadership by developing architecture roadmaps, strategic recommendations, technology assessments, and executive-level briefing materials that support enterprise decision-making.
  • Mentor architects and advance enterprise data architecture maturity through coaching, architecture practice leadership, standards development, and continuous evaluation of emerging data, AI, cloud, and regulatory trends.

Education or Equivalent Experience:
  • Bachelor of Arts or Science Computer Science, Computer Engineering, Information Systems, or related field (Required)
  • And 15+ years Information Technology, Computer Science, Information Systems, Data Science, or a related field, with demonstrated depth in enterprise data architecture, cloud data platforms, and data governance in complex, multi-domain organizational environments (Required)
  • And 7+ years Data Architecture experience at enterprise scale, with demonstrated delivery of data platform strategies, lakehouse architectures, data governance frameworks, and data product architecture contributions; prior experience in healthcare, academic medical center, or regulated industry environments (Required)
  • 3+ years Healthcare Life Science, Provider, Academic or Payer Experience (Preferred)
